Cosa fa PHP?

Corso PHP e MySQLVerrebbe da dire che PHP può fare tutto perché è un linguaggio molto eclettico. È innanzitutto un linguaggio di scripting che viene interpretato da un Server. PHP viene utilizzato principalmente per sviluppare delle applicazioni Web dal lato Server (ricordiamo che quando navighiamo sul web il nostro computer  si collega ad un computer SERVENTE per ricavare le informazioni richieste), ma come anticipato può essere usato anche per applicazioni Stand alone (che funzionano anche senza connessioni) che abbiano un interfaccia grafica, ad esempio Wikipedia è scritta anche con PHP.

Obiettivi del Corso PHP e MySQL

L’obiettivo del corso Php e MySQL è senza dubbio quello di formare un programmatore che abbia reale dimestichezza con questo linguaggio. Utilizzato maggiormente per lo sviluppo e la struttura dei siti Web, sia nativi che realizzati con CMS, richiede una formazione più specifica. Il corso, che favorisce le lezioni pratiche a quelle teoriche, viene sempre tenuto da programmatori esperti che non si appoggiano ai classici esempi da libro ma cercano di trasferire all’allievo anche la propria esperienza nel settore. Seguito con impegno, il corso Php e MySQL può segnare una svolta professionale per chi si occupa di siti Web.

Certificazioni

Il corso Php e MySQL, al termine della formazione completata con profitto, rilascia un attestato numerato e personale, tracciabile attraverso il sito Web con certificazione ente ISO 9001:2015 EA37 per la formazione professionale valida in tutta Europa. Inoltre è possibile sostenere anche l’esame di certificazione ICPHP.

RICHIEDI GRATUITAMENTE MAGGIORI INFORMAZIONI SUL Corso PHP e MySQL

Scopri la data del prossimo Corso PHP e MySQL, il costo del corso e le modalità di svolgimento… compila i campi di seguito

  • Questo campo serve per la convalida e dovrebbe essere lasciato inalterato.
Contattaci WhatsApp
Contattaci Whatsapp
Contattaci Telegram
Contattaci Telegram
Richiedi Informazioni Email
Contattaci Tramite Email
Contattaci Telefonicamente
Contattaci Telefonicamente
Contattaci Whatsapp
Contattaci Telegram
Contattaci Telefonicamente
Contattaci Tramite Email

Modalità di erogazione

Le nostre modalità di erogazione del Corso PHP e MySQL

Descrizione del Corso PHP e MySQL

Il corso Php e MySQL, in aula e online, è dedicato a te che vuoi realizzare pagine dinamiche con collegamenti a database relazionali come My Sql. I siti moderni sono davvero belli e funzionali, ma come funzionano?
Il corso Php e MySQL, in aula e online, ti darà gli strumenti per creare siti dinamici in PHP: dare vita a pagine di login, form compilabili, interi forum, gallerie di immagini, e-commerce e molto altro ancora non sarà più un miraggio…

Il PHP e il MySQL sono i linguaggi più utilizzati nel mondo di internet e consentono la realizzazione di applicazioni Web professionali. Se vuoi progettare siti complessi, dinamici, che offrano interazione con l’utente, non puoi non conoscere PHP. La conoscenza e la padronanza del linguaggio PHP, unita alla sua possibilità di interazione con diversi database, ti permetterà la creazione di applicazioni Web in qualsiasi ambito professionale. Il programmatore web è una delle figure più richieste dal mercato del lavoro odierno: se non vuoi perdere un’occasione del genere, questo è il corso giusto per te!

La metodologia del corso, tanta pratica applicata ad esempi concreti, ti garantirà l’autonomia una volta terminato, il percorso infatti è più vicino ad uno stage formativo e ti metterà in condizioni di operare autonomamente o collaborare senza alcun problema con professionisti che da anni operano nel settore.

Dettagli sul Corso PHP e MySQL

DURATA

40 ore di attività formativa

REQUISITI

Il corso Php e MySQL può essere personalizzato per le varie applicazione e per i vari livelli di competenza iniziali ma per partecipare al corso è obbligatoria la conoscenza di HTML (opzionale quella di CSS) sono apprezzate, inoltre, la passione per l’argomento e l’impegno costante durante il corso.

SBOCCHI LAVORATIVI

Php e MySQL sono utilizzati soprattutto nel settore dei siti Web; per cui chi vuole diventare un Web Master non dovrebbe prescindere da questa conoscenza. Che si realizzino siti di tipo nativo o ci si appoggi a CMS come WordPress o Joomla questa competenza aumenta di molto le capacità di personalizzare il prodotto finale. Per questo Web Agency o aziende informatiche in genere sono sempre alla ricerca di questa competenza. Se poi si vuole intraprendere la libera professione come Web Master allora il linguaggio segna la differenza tra un professionista ed un amatoriale.

Dettagli sul Corso PHP e MySQL

DURATA

40 ore di attività formativa

REQUISITI

Il corso Php e MySQL può essere personalizzato per le varie applicazione e per i vari livelli di competenza iniziali ma per partecipare al corso è obbligatoria la conoscenza di HTML (opzionale quella di CSS) sono apprezzate, inoltre, la passione per l’argomento e l’impegno costante durante il corso.

SBOCCHI PROFESSIONALI

Php e MySQL sono utilizzati soprattutto nel settore dei siti Web; per cui chi vuole diventare un Web Master non dovrebbe prescindere da questa conoscenza. Che si realizzino siti di tipo nativo o ci si appoggi a CMS come WordPress o Joomla questa competenza aumenta di molto le capacità di personalizzare il prodotto finale. Per questo Web Agency o aziende informatiche in genere sono sempre alla ricerca di questa competenza. Se poi si vuole intraprendere la libera professione come Web Master allora il linguaggio segna la differenza tra un professionista ed un amatoriale.

Lezione di Prova Gratuita
Certificazione ISO

Programma del Corso PHP e MySQL

Programma PHP MySql

  • Introduzione a Php;
  • Ambiente di sviluppo;
  • Sintassi;
  • Echo e print;
  • I commenti;
  • Le variabili;
  • Costanti;
  • Data Types PHP;
  • Funzioni stringa;
  • Modificare una stringa;
  • Gestione delle date in PHP;
  • Operatori matematici di PHP;
  • Incrementare e decrementare una variabile numerica;
  • Gli operatori di confronto;
  • Dichiarazioni condizionali (if else);
  • Istruzione SWITCH;
  • Gli array;
  • Ciclo while;
  • Ciclo for;
  • Ciclo foreach;
  • Variabili superglobali;
  • Gestione dei moduli PHP;
  • GET e POST;
  • Form e campi obbligatori;
  • Creare il modulo di Upload;
  • I COOKIE;
  • Le Sessioni;
  • Le funzioni;
  • Introduzione ai Database;
  • I campi e i record;
  • I Database relazionali;
  • La funzione delle chiavi primarie e chiavi secondarie;
  • Tipi di relazioni (uno a uno, Uno a molti, molti a molti);
  • Introduzione a MySql;
  • Data Types MySql;
  • L’istruzione CREATE DATABASE;
  • L’istruzione DROP;
  • L’istruzione CREATE TABLE;
  • L’istruzione DROP TABLE;
  • L’istruzione ALTER TABLE;
  • I Vincoli NOT NULL, UNIQUE, PRIMARY KEY, DEFAULT;
  • Gli Indici;
  • funzione di incremento automatico;
  • L’istruzione INSERT INTO;
  • L’istruzione SELECT;
  • La clausola WHERE;
  • Gli operatori AND, OR e NOT;
  • La clausola ORDER BY;
  • L’istruzione UPDATE;
  • L’istruzione DELETE;
  • Le funzioni MIN () e MAX ();
  • Le funzioni COUNT (), AVG () e SUM ();
  • Operatori matematici;
  • L’operatore LIKE;
  • MySQL UNION;
  • FOREIGN KEY;
  • L’istruzione MySQL GROUP BY;
  • MySQL JOIN;
  • SQL INJECTION;
  • Query con PHP;
  • Login;
  • Creazione di un CRUD;
  • Le classi;
  • Le proprietà e i metodi;
  • Istanziare una classe;
  • Costruttori e distruttori;
  • Modificatori di accesso;
  • Le sottoclassi;
  • Classi astratte;
  • I namespace;
  • Creazione di un CRUD con la programmazione ad oggetti.

Nozioni base di JSON

  • Il formato Json;
  • Convertire una stringa JSON in PHP;
  • Convertire un array in JSON:
    1. per recuperare dei dati da un database e trasformarli in JSON;
    2. salvare il contenuto di una variabile PHP in un file JSON;
    3. file_get_contents().

Nozioni base di cURL

  • Come utilizzare cURL in PHP per effettuare chiamate in GET o POST ad un web service;
  • Inizializzare una sessione cURL utilizzando la funzione curl_init;
  • Impostare le opzioni di una sessione Curl, ricorrendo alla funzione curl_setopt;
  • Utilizziare la funzione curl_exec per effettuare la chiamataChiudere la sessione cURL con la funzione curl_close;
  • Esempio base di utilizzo di cURL;
  • Le opzioni principali di cURL;
  • Impostare la URL della risorsa remota;
  • Impostare un timeout;
  • Restituire l’output sotto forma di stringa;
  • Utilizzare cURL per copiare in locale un file remoto;
  • Inviare dei dati col metodo POST;
  • Inviare dei dati nel formato JSON ad un web-service remoto;

Gestione dei ruoli e dei permessi

  • Come creare un sistema di gestione dei ruoli utente con MySQL PHP;
  • Login con identificazione dei ruoli;
  • creazione di una struttura di autorizzazioni nel database (users, roles, permissions, roles_permissions);
  • Inserimento dei ruoli e attribuzione dei permessi per specificare le autorizzazioni;
  • Identificazione e limitazione dei ruoli sulle operazioni con i permessi.

Gestione delle tabelle con dataTables

  • Tabelle con dataTables

Gestione degli appuntamenti con FullCalendar

  • Come creare un sistema di appuntamenti con Php/Mysql utilizzando il plug-in FullCalendar;
  • Creazione di una tabella mysql per permettere al singolo utente di gestire il calendario in autonomia;
  • Inserimento dell’evento o appuntamento;
  • Aggiornare l’evento;
  • Cancellare l’evento;
  • Interfaccia grafica con calendario.

Domande frequenti

PHP è un linguaggio di Scripting che però può avere molte applicazioni e serve soprattutto per creare e gestire applicazioni Web.

Perché è un linguaggio che ha pochi limiti, ottimo per il Web, ma anche per applicazioni Stand alone oppure per il collegamento con server e Database.

Con Php posso creare applicazioni per il web migliorando le funzionalità o le prestazioni di un sito Web. I campi di applicazione sono quello del World Wide Web (www)

A chi opera nel settore e ha necessità di ottimizzare o migliorare le proprie competenze.

Il corso punta ad un’autonomia acquisita da parte dell’allievo. Quindi lezioni dirette, chiare e molto pratiche

Se necessario si può valutare un linguaggio come Javascript. Ma deve essere veramente necessario.